The temperature inside the container is raised by utilizing compressed heat through the pressurized circulation of gas and air.
Cylinder 100Φ, compression stroke 15mm, intake pressure 0.5MPa, discharge pressure 0.9MPa, motor output 3-phase 200V 2.2kW, discharge flow rate 500L/min, CO2 gas discharge temperature 90℃.

In regular inspections such as pressure and leak tests for mobile tanks, the compression heat from the compressor is used as a substitute for heaters to raise the temperature inside the tank. The discharge volume and pressure are designed and manufactured according to requirements.

Applications/Examples of results
In the pressurized circulation of CO2 gas, the temperature inside the container is raised to the inspection temperature.
